Mozilla: IonMonkey leaks JS_OPTIMIZED_OUT magic value to script
The IonMonkey just-in-time JIT compiler can leak an internal JSOPTIMIZEDOUT magic value to the running script during a bailout. This magic value can then be used by JavaScript to achieve memory corruption, which results in a potentially exploitable crash. This vulnerability affects Thunderbird...

Mozilla: Type inference is incorrect for constructors entered through on-stack replacement with IonMonkey
The type inference system allows the compilation of functions that can cause type confusions between arbitrary objects when compiled through the IonMonkey just-in-time JIT compiler and when the constructor function is entered through on-stack replacement OSR. This allows for possible arbitrary...
